Multiply 15/72 with 28/7

1st number: 15/72, 2nd number: 4 0/7

This multiplication involving fractions can also be rephrased as "What is 15/72 of 4 0/7?"

15/72 × 28/7 is 5/6.

Steps for multiplying fractions

  1. Simply multiply the numerators and denominators separately:
  2. 15/72 × 28/7 = 15 × 28/72 × 7 = 420/504
  3.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 5/6
